Marino Illescas Montaño (born 5 May 2001) is a Spanish footballer who plays as a midfielder for Arenteiro, on loan from Algeciras. [1]
Illescas was born in Écija, Seville, Andalusia, and joined Sevilla FC's youth setup in 2018, from hometown side Écija Balompié. [2] In August 2020, after finishing his formation, he signed for Deportivo Alavés and was assigned to the reserves in Segunda División B. [3]
In 2022, Illescas moved to another reserve team, Burgos CF Promesas in Segunda Federación. [4] He made his first team debut on 15 January of the following year, coming on as a late substitute for Álex Bermejo in a 2–1 Segunda División home win over FC Andorra. [5] [6]
